India's first dengue vaccine, Qdenga, requires careful rollout and affordability for at-risk populations.
The CDSCO's approval of Qdenga, India's first dengue vaccine, is a significant step, following its licensing in over 40 countries and WHO prequalification. However, the editorial cautions against complacency. Concerns include the vaccine's varying protection against different serotypes (especially DENV-3 and DENV-4), the two-dose regimen's logistical challenges for mobile populations, and potential 'negative efficacy' issues in seronegative children from the TIDES trial. The article stresses the need for government negotiation for lower pricing to ensure affordability and uptake among high-risk populations, particularly in dense urban slums where conventional vector control is difficult.

Exam Facts
- CDSCO (Central Drugs Standard Control Organisation) approved the Qdenga dengue vaccine.
- Qdenga is developed by Japan-based Takeda.
- There are four antigenically distinct dengue serotypes (DENV-1, DENV-2, DENV-3, DENV-4).
- The TIDES trial raised concerns about 'negative efficacy' against DENV-3 among seronegative children.
- The Aedes mosquitoes spread dengue.
